Course Description:

Flat, with holes strategically tucked amidst pines and palmettos. Alt. tees. 2 spring ponds for swimming.

Course Established: 1991

Additional Course Information:

Additional Course Information for Wickham Park:

course has tee signs
restrooms available
camping available nearby

Directions:

I-95; exit 191, take Wickham Rd. east, veers south past Brevard Community College, left on Parkway Dr. - half mile to park entrance on left. Follow left fork of Wickham Park Dr. to course just past pond on left, 0.4 mile from park entrance.

Nice course that's fun to play. My only problem was that I could not find my way around and got lost after the 2nd hole. I looked and looked and looked, but never did find a tee or hole marked "3". This course desperately needs better marking of the tees and baskets and a course map. There are some signs, but they don't all make sense. What do you do with a basket marked "B"? I tried following some other players, but they got lost as well. I ended up playing a semi-random selection of tees/baskets, but I got in a good 18 holes and enjoyed whatever it was that I played. If this course were well-marked, I would have given it a 4 out of 5, instead of 3.
